Ahura Mazda is the name of the supreme god in Zoroastrianism, which is one of the world's oldest religions, founded in ancient Persia (now Iran). He represents truth, light, and goodness, and is believed to be the creator of the universe. Zoroastrians believe that Ahura Mazda is in constant struggle against evil, represented by Angra Mainyu, the spirit of chaos and darkness. Followers of Zoroastrianism strive to live good lives by following the teachings of the prophet Zoroaster, honoring Ahura Mazda, and promoting truth and righteousness in their daily actions.
